The decisive qualifying match will take place on November 20
Midfielder Ukrainian national team Georgy Sudakov commented on the upcoming match with the national team Italy in qualification European Championship 2024.
“Italy are very strong, they are the current European champions, I respect them a lot. But we will fight for victory and make every effort. Victory over Italy and qualifying for the Euro is our dream. After the world, obviously.”
“The mistake in the last match with Italy was, of course, not a pleasant experience, but I’m moving forward. I don’t think about the past. My position on the field requires a lot of responsibility, but I like having that kind of weight, even taking risks.”
Sergei Rebrov’s team will hold a sparring match against Lechia, which is currently represented by Ukrainians Bogdan Sarnavsky, Ivan Zhelizko and Maxim Khlan, as well as ex-Krivbass player Rifet Kapic. The meeting will take place on November 16, starting at 17:00.
The Ukrainian team takes second place in Group C, three points ahead of Italy. Squadra Azzurra played one match less and will play against North Macedonia on November 17.
Sergei Rebrov’s team will play against Italy on November 20 in Leverkusen (Germany) at the Bay Arena stadium, starting at 20:45 local time or at 21:45 Kyiv time. At the end of October, ticket sales for the final match of the blue-yellows in the group round of qualifying began.
